I was having the endless reboot problem with my USB memory stick installing Ubuntu 14.04. I forget how I built my bootable USB stick, but I just burned the .ISO to a DVD and booted with that. Problem solved.
So I think it's the certain tool people are using to make their USB sticks from the .ISO that's the culprit here.
